Israeli authorities are investigating reports that Qatar paid around ten million dollars to security veterans and associates of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u over a two and a half year period. The payments are linked to 'Lighthouse,' an influence campaign launched ahead of the Qatar World Cup, which aimed to improve Qatar's image globally, especially within Jewish communities. The campaign reportedly used avatars and virtual influencers on social media to promote Qatar as a peace-seeking nation. The probe is based on financial tracking by police and the national anti-money laundering authority.
